Itinerary

On the first day, travelers are picked up from their Cusco hotel and enjoy breakfast in Cusipata. Then, they trek through small towns, flora, and fauna before reaching the slopes of Ausangate for lunch. Afterward, they hike to the Circular Lagoon, enjoying sunset views and a waterfall before settling in for dinner and a campfire.

On the second day, travelers enjoy breakfast with mountain views before ascending to Rainbow Mountain and touring the site. They then visit the Red Valley before descending to Chillca for lunch and returning to Cusco.

Inclusions

This guided trip includes hotel pickup near the historic center of Cusco and round trip tourist transportation.

A bilingual guide leads the way, and all meals are provided – 2 breakfasts, 2 lunches, and 1 dinner.

Hiking essentials like walking sticks, first aid, and oxygen are available. Cozy mountain tents (2 people per tent) are set up, along with dining and kitchen facilities.

A cook and kitchen assistant ensure a comfortable camping experience. Porters transfer extra luggage (6 kilos per person) throughout the trek.

Health and Safety Considerations

Ensuring participant safety is paramount on the Rainbow Mountain trek. All guides are trained in first aid and carry emergency oxygen. During the hike, walking sticks and a first aid kit are provided.

Altitude sickness can occur at high elevations, so travelers should acclimate in Cusco before the trek. Guides monitor participants and can arrange for emergency horse transport if needed.

Participants should dress in warm, layered clothing, wear proper hiking boots, and stay hydrated. Though the views are stunning, travelers must be prepared for the physical demands of the trail. Safety is the top priority on this adventure.
